What is the difference between Entry Level Travel Manager vs Travel Coordinator?

AspectEntry Level Travel ManagerTravel Coordinator
CredentialsHigh school diploma; some roles prefer certifications in travel or hospitalityHigh school diploma; certifications are optional but beneficial
Work EnvironmentCorporate offices, travel agencies, or online platformsTravel agencies, corporate offices, or client sites
ResponsibilitiesOverseeing travel arrangements, managing budgets, coordinating with vendorsBooking travel, handling itineraries, customer service
Industry UsageCommonly used in corporate and agency settingsWidely used in travel agencies and corporate travel departments

Both roles involve travel planning, but Entry Level Travel Managers typically handle broader responsibilities and oversee travel operations, while Travel Coordinators focus on booking and customer service. The roles often overlap in work environment and required skills, making them common points of comparison for those entering the travel industry.

Job description

Medical Diagnostic Laboratories (MDL), a member of Genesis Global Group, is a CLIA certified clinical laboratory with multiple state licensing, specializing in state of the art, automated DNA based molecular analysis of a variety of chronic and infectious illnesses.
MDL specializes and performs Polymerase Chain Reaction (PCR) with a larger menu of testing available in the field of infectious disease. Our main theme of research is in the field of Gynecology, Infectious Diseases, Infectious Arthritis, Tick-borne Diseases, Mycology, and Chronic Fatigue Syndrome (CFS).
MDL is looking to expand its sales force throughout the U.S. We are seeking a high-energy, self-motivated individual to join our sales team. As an Entry Level Account Manager, you will be responsible for maintaining a large client base of existing customers for MDL and serve as a liaison between management and customers to resolve any customer issues.
Essential Functions:
  • Grow client base revenues by presenting new test information, up selling and seeking out new sources of revenue from existing clients
  • Establish positive long-term client relations
  • Educate and train clients, research problems and coordinate solutions between the laboratory and client
  • Work closely with Senior Sales Executive and Regional Manager to identify client concerns and assist in the development and implementation of client retention strategies
  • Monitor, evaluate, and report level of client satisfaction and recommend appropriate corrective action as required
  • Maintain knowledge of competitors and their presence in assigned territory

Job Qualifications: General Knowledge, Skills, and Abilities (KSA's) required
  • 1-3 years of successful customer service experience.
  • Well-developed multi-tasking, organizational skills, and detail orientation are key to success
  • Energy, motivation, enthusiasm, and integrity
  • Excellent written and verbal communication skills
  • Must demonstrate sound judgment and decision-making ability
  • Computer proficiency in MS Office, Excel, e-mail and internet functions
  • Knowledge of laboratory testing and competing products.
  • Must be able to travel within the coverage area and occasionally nationwide

Physical Demands: Physical, Mental and Workplace Environment Conditions
  • Use hands to handle, control, or feel objects, tools, or controls
  • Ability to sit, stand and walk
  • Ability to drive motor vehicle

Workplace Conditions: Workplace Environment Conditions
  • Requires frequent traveling by motor vehicle
  • May be exposed to various workplace environments when meeting with customers

Education and Certifications:
  • Medical Assistant certification or Associate Degree, BA/BS preferred.
